Brad and the #2 Team are the real deal. Their race strategy and Brad's Tenacity might just give Roger Penske his first Cup Series Championship ... something Rusty Wallace, Kurt Busch and other drivers could not do.
In fact, Brad gave Penske their 1st *ever* NASCAR Series Championship when he won the Nationwide Title a couple of years ago.
It would be quite the swansong for Dodge if that team could do it!
